Is blood pressure high or low after exercise

Blood pressure is elevated after exercise because the heart is under high load after strenuous exercise, and the heart rate is much faster than usual, and the number of times the heart pumps blood and the amount of blood ejected is also much higher than usual, so the pressure of human blood will be higher than usual, resulting in an increase in blood pressure after exercise. If the blood pressure rises after exercise, there are also symptoms of discomfort, such as chest tightness, shortness of breath, panic, palpitations, and even fainting, then go to the hospital as soon as possible to check the electrocardiogram, cardiac ultrasound, nuclear myocardial imaging and other tests to determine whether the condition is caused by physiological or pathological diseases. If it is a pathological disease that causes increased blood pressure after exercise, medication is needed for specific treatment.
